To prevent possible leaking, make sure that the valve, fittings and pipe are properly aligned.Īfter all pipe and fittings have been installed, turn the water supply on and check for leaks with the valve closed. Valves have tapered fittings and therefore require seven to eight turns of thread seal tape to prevent leaking and to guard against the connections bottoming out. Note arrow on valve for water flow direction. INSTALLING THE VALVEĪfter flushing line, install the valve using appropriate fittings (not included) for your system (see figure below). NOTE: The % symbol will show on the screen when the value for A or B is anything other than 100%. Press or to set the budget value (10% - 200%). Set the value to 100% to water exactly as programmed.įor a 10 minute run time, 50% will reduce it to be 5 minutes and 200% will increase it to 20 minutes. NOTE: This feature allows for seasonal adjustments. No watering may occur while in the Off position. NOTE: Manual watering of a set program (A or B) will only work after programming has been set up.
